<dcvalue element="description" qualifier="abstract">Nonenzymatic&#x20;reactions,&#x20;though&#x20;critical&#x20;in&#x20;natural&#x20;product&#x20;biosynthesis,&#x20;are&#x20;significantly&#x20;challenging&#x20;to&#x20;control.&#x20;Adding&#x20;3%&#x20;NaI&#x20;to&#x20;the&#x20;culture&#x20;medium&#x20;of&#x20;Penicillium&#x20;janczewskii&#x20;significantly&#x20;increased&#x20;pseurotin&#x20;D&#x20;(1)&#x20;production&#x20;and&#x20;decreased&#x20;pseurotin&#x20;A&#x20;(2)&#x20;production.&#x20;Previously,&#x20;1&#x20;and&#x20;2&#x20;were&#x20;suggested&#x20;to&#x20;be&#x20;produced&#x20;via&#x20;a&#x20;nonenzymatic&#x20;reaction,&#x20;where&#x20;the&#x20;epoxide&#x20;at&#x20;C-10&#x20;undergoes&#x20;SN2&#x20;(2)&#x20;or&#x20;SN2&#x20;&amp;apos;&#x20;(1)&#x20;reactions.&#x20;We&#x20;confirmed&#x20;that&#x20;1&#x20;was&#x20;isolated&#x20;as&#x20;a&#x20;1:1&#x20;mixture&#x20;of&#x20;C-13&#x20;epimers&#x20;by&#x20;spectral&#x20;elucidation&#x20;via&#x20;CP3&#x20;analysis&#x20;aided&#x20;by&#x20;selective&#x20;excitation&#x20;NMR&#x20;methods,&#x20;which&#x20;supported&#x20;that&#x20;1&#x20;was&#x20;produced&#x20;through&#x20;a&#x20;nonenzymatic&#x20;SN2&#x20;&amp;apos;&#x20;reaction.&#x20;We&#x20;propose&#x20;that&#x20;NaI&#x20;increased&#x20;the&#x20;ratio&#x20;of&#x20;1&#x20;by&#x20;causing&#x20;steric&#x20;hindrance&#x20;at&#x20;the&#x20;C-11&#x20;position&#x20;of&#x20;the&#x20;transient&#x20;intermediate,&#x20;which&#x20;makes&#x20;C-13&#x20;more&#x20;preferred&#x20;in&#x20;the&#x20;SN2&#x2F;SN2&#x20;&amp;apos;&#x20;competition.</dcvalue>
